New Jersey DEP grants Final Field Certification for Hydro Int'l Up-Flo Filter

Feb. 17, 2015 -- After demonstrating pollutant removal that met or exceeded the requirements of the Technology Acceptance Reciprocity Partnership (TARP) field testing protocol, the Up-Flo® Filter from Hydro International, a supplier of water, wastewater and stormwater treatment and control technologies, has resulted in Final Field Certification (FFC) from the New Jersey Department of Environmental Protection (NJDEP).

The conditions of the FFC allow the Up-Flo Filter with CPZ Mix™ filter media to be used to treat up to 0.056 CFS (25 GPM) per filter module with a maximum inflow area of 0.66 acres per filter module. The FFC improves upon the Interim Certification first issued by the NJDEP in December 2009, which approved the Up-Flo Filter to treat up to 0.045 CFS (20 GPM) per filter module with a maximum inflow area of 0.3 acres per filter module.

The field testing was conducted on an Up-Flo Filter installation along the Tuscaloosa Riverwalk in the city of Tuscaloosa, Ala., an area known for its intense rainfalls and clayey soils. Sampling and analysis were conducted independently by the University of Alabama's Civil, Construction and Environmental Engineering department.

Over the course of the monitoring period, the Up-Flo Filter was subjected to a number of high-intensity storms and a very high pollutant loading. Overall, the Up-Flo Filter demonstrated 89-percent removal of total suspended solids (TSS), 98-percent removal of all suspended sediment and 81-percent removal of suspended sediment with a mean particle size of 29 microns.

The Up-Flo Filter is available in a standard 4-foot manhole configuration, in a range of precast concrete vault sizes. Likewise, Hydro provides a free downloadable Up-Flo Filter Sizing Calculator to help engineers with sizing the correct filter for each application and dedicated technical team to offer additional support.
